Magnetic Knife Strips: Sleek Blade Storage
Wall-mounted magnetic strips keep knives visible, sharp, and drawer-free.
Wooden or bamboo magnetic strips — Acacia or walnut bars (16–18 inches, like Gourmetop or Ouddy models) with strong N50 magnets mount via screws or 3M adhesive. No-drill options suit renters—pair with backsplash or above sink for easy reach.
Stainless steel or matte black strips — Sleek modern designs (Modern Innovations or similar) resist fingerprints and add industrial edge—great for minimalist kitchens.
Placement ideas — Above the sink (tucked high for safety), behind the stove, on backsplash, or inside cabinet doors for hidden access. Hang in a row or staggered for visual interest.
Hack — Use multiple shorter strips (10–12 inches) side-by-side for larger collections; add small S-hooks for scissors or peelers.
These strips protect blades (no dulling from blocks) and add clean, pro-chef style.
Wall Rails & Multi-Tool Magnetic Systems
Extend magnets beyond knives for full wall organization.
Magnetic rails with hooks — Stainless steel or brass rails (wall-mounted) hold knives plus hanging tools—add S-hooks for ladles, whisks, or measuring spoons.
Magnetic bars for utensils — Slim bars inside cabinets or on walls store metal tools (tongs, can openers, thermometers)—keeps counters clear.
Pegboard + magnetic combo — Mount a metal pegboard with magnetic strips—hang non-magnetic items on pegs, metal ones directly on magnets.
Hack — Position near prep zone for workflow; use strong adhesive for tile/glass surfaces or screws for wood/drywall.

Styling & Safety Tips
- Height & safety — Mount 48–60 inches high (out of child reach); position away from heat sources.
- Strength — Choose N50+ magnets for heavy knives; test hold before full use.
- Aesthetics — Match finish to hardware (brass/gold for warmth, black for modern); add small plants or art nearby for balance.
- Maintenance — Wipe strips regularly; avoid overloading.
- Budget — Start with a 16-inch adhesive strip ($15–$25)—high impact, low cost.
